Cameroon: Indomitable lions lose four places in recent FIFA rankings of national football teams
Despite being African champions, coupled with the fact that, the lions are just from representing the Continent in a major international competition, the team has lose four places in the FIFA ranking of the month of July 2017. Cameroon which hitherto was ranked 2nd in Africa, now occupies the 5th position and 36th in the world retreating four places backward.
Some football pundits and observers predicts the premature exit of the lions from the confederations cup could be the raison d'être of the team's fall from the rankings of the world governing football body, FIFA. But on the other hand, many still finds it difficult to understand why even when Cameroon won the African cup of Nations (AFCON)2017 in Gabon, they were ranked 2nd behind their runners up Egypt. Nonetheless, the criteria for ranking are the sole prerogative of the supreme organ in charge of the management of global football.
In the African continent, Egypt is ranked 1st and 24th in the world, followed by the 2017 AFCON semi finalist, Senegal who is 27th in the world and DR Congo comes 3rd and 28th in the world. Tunisia, Cameroon, Nigeria, Burkina Faso, Algeria, Ghana and Cote D'Ivoire makes up the 10 best teams in the continent.
Meanwhile at the global level, Germany has regained its top position as the best football team in the world following their new title as champions of the confederations cup coupled with the world cup title they are keeping. Brazil, Argentina, Portugal, Switzerland, Poland, Chile, Colombia, France and Belgium forms the bond of the ten most strongest football nations on the planet. The greatest surprise amongst the ten is Poland which is considered as a football underdog in Europe and even in the world.
The next ranking comes up on the 10th of August 2017.
